Product Description:
The MDD090A-N-020-N2L-130GB0 synchronous motor is manufactured by Bosch Rexroth Indramat within the MDD Synchronous Motors series. Classified as a motor for digital drive controllers, it interfaces directly with Rexroth servo drives to deliver precise rotary power for automated pick-and-place tables, light conveyor sections, and indexing fixtures on production lines where repeatable motion is required. Closed-loop operation is supported by digital servo feedback, which sends position data to the controller so it can correct speed deviations and maintain stable axis response during changing load conditions.
This model can hold a load motionless at a continuous torque of 3.7 Nm, which helps match the motor to couplings and gear stages used in static duty without overloading the drivetrain. Under rated electrical frequency, it reaches a nominal speed of 2000 rpm for continuous cycling applications that need moderate axis speed with controlled acceleration. A centering diameter of 130 mm provides an accurate seating surface that keeps the stator concentric with machine frames and reduces alignment error during mounting. Power and feedback conductors exit on Side B, so cable routing can stay on the non-process side and away from nearby tooling or transferred material. A single locking connector combines power, signal, and protective earth paths in one interface, which keeps the connection layout compact.
The motor is supplied without a blocking brake, so any vertical or safety-critical axis must use external clamping or drive-torque hold during power loss or planned stops. A plain shaft reduces stress concentrations when connected to zero-backlash couplings and suits applications that do not require a keyed output. A fitted shaft seal protects the bearing set from coolant splash and airborne debris, which helps preserve bearing life in general factory environments. This shaft arrangement supports accurate coupling alignment and smooth torque transfer during repetitive motion.
